    Leaking water heater valve
    The pressure relief valve started leaking on our water heater after seven years. I replaced the valve but it is still leaking. Is there another problem with the water heater or do I need to get a new one?
  • May 26, 2013, 11:03 AM
    ma0641
    Problem is most likely with the Pressure Regulating Valve on the water supply. You need to measure the water pressure at the HW heater, it should not exceed 70#.
  • May 26, 2013, 08:59 PM
    mygirlsdad77
    Actually, code in almost all of the united states says it shall not exceed 80psi.
